To navigate means to plan, direct, or plot a path or course from one location to another. this term can be used broadly to refer to a variety of contexts including physical travel, interaction with an environment, or management of complex systems or information. Used of a passenger: you drive; i'll navigate. c. to know or determine a migratory course. used of an animal: how do butterflies navigate when they migrate? 2. a. to travel over a planned course or route, especially in a boat or ship: the sailors navigated to their favored fishing grounds. To travel through or over (water, air, or land) in a ship or aircraft. to give directions to the driver of an automobile, especially by reading a map. used of a passenger. you drive; i'll navigate. to travel by ship. to know or determine a migratory course. used of an animal. how do butterflies navigate when they migrate?. Navigate (third person singular simple present navigates, present participle navigating, simple past and past participle navigated) (transitive) to plan, control and record the position and course of a vehicle, ship, aircraft, etc., on a journey; to follow a planned course.
